Record-holder Birchall earns 23rd cap
Port Vale’s most capped player, Chris Birchall earned his 23rd cap while a Vale player after playing the full ninety minutes of Trinidad and Tobago’s friendly with Belize.
The 28 year-old Birchall making his first International appearance of his second spell with the Vale started the 0-0 draw at the FPP Stadium.
The midfielder is also set to feaure in T&T’s second friendly which takes place on Tuesday evening against Peru. Should Birchall impress he will come into contention for T&T’s Concacaf Gold Cup which takes place in the summer.
It has been a good couple of weeks for Birchall who earned his International recall and has forced his way into the Vale starting eleven in recent games.
Birchall the trailblazer
28 year-old Chris Birchall is the club’s most capped player. The midfielder has been picked on 23 occasions by Trinidad and Tobago. It includes games in the World Cup finals making Birchall the only Vale player to appear in a World Cup while contracted to the club.
